Crafting a standout resume can feel daunting, but by implementing effective writing tips and tricks, you can showcase your skills and experience in the best possible light. Start by tailoring your resume to each specific job application, underscoring relevant keywords from the job description. Quantify your achievements whenever feasible, using numbers and metrics to demonstrate your impact. Utilize a clear and concise writing style, avoiding jargon and overly complex sentence structures. Structure your resume logically with distinct sections for your experience, education, skills, and any relevant certifications or awards. Proofread meticulously for any grammatical errors or typos, as even minor mistakes can negatively impact your application's success.

  • Consider including a compelling summary statement at the top of your resume to capture the reader's attention and succinctly outline your key qualifications.
  • Leverage action verbs to describe your responsibilities and accomplishments, making your resume more dynamic and engaging to read.
  • Use bullet points to present information in a clear and scannable format, improving readability.

Remember, your resume is your first impression, so invest the time and effort to create a polished and professional document that truly represents your value.
